Latest Patents
Okamoto's notable patent involves a novel resin fan that improves mechanical strength at weld points concerning the direction of reinforcing fibers. This innovative design includes a cylindrical rib with convex parts formed between the radial ribs that connect to the rib. The design ensures that the thickness of the cylindrical rib tapers from its base to the tip, while the height of the cylindrical rib is larger than that of the radial rib. This specific design allows for a complex flow of resin during molding, enhancing the orientation of the glass fibers mixed into the material, thus optimizing the overall strength and performance of the fan.
Career Highlights
Okamoto is employed at Mitsubishi Heavy Industries Limited, a leading player in the industries of manufacturing and engineering in Japan. His work here focuses on developing advanced fan systems utilizing resin materials which serve various applications in industrial machinery.
